Biography of Diddy
Sean John Combs, widely known by his stage names Puff Daddy, P. Diddy, and simply Diddy, is a renowned American rapper, singer, record producer, and entrepreneur. Born on November 4, 1969, in Harlem, New York City, he has become one of the most influential figures in the music and entertainment industries. Diddy is the founder of Bad Boy Records, a label that has launched the careers of many successful artists.

Early Life and Background
Diddy's early life was marked by both challenges and opportunities. Growing up in Harlem, he was exposed to the vibrant culture and music scene that would later influence his career. His father, Melvin Combs, was associated with a notorious drug dealer, which led to his untimely death when Diddy was just two years old. Despite this tragic loss, his mother, Janice Combs, played a pivotal role in raising him and instilling a strong work ethic.
He attended the prestigious Mount Saint Michael Academy, where he excelled in sports and academics. Diddy's passion for music began to blossom during his college years at Howard University, where he studied business. Although he eventually dropped out to pursue a career in music, his time at Howard laid the foundation for his future entrepreneurial endeavors.
Rise to Fame
Diddy's rise to fame can be attributed to his keen business acumen and undeniable talent. After leaving Howard University, he worked as an intern at Uptown Records, where he quickly climbed the ranks to become a talent director. During his tenure, he played a crucial role in shaping the careers of artists like Mary J. Blige and Jodeci.
In 1993, Diddy founded Bad Boy Records, a label that would soon become synonymous with success and innovation in the music industry. Under his leadership, the label signed iconic artists such as The Notorious B.I.G., Faith Evans, and 112. Diddy's production skills and visionary approach to artist development helped propel these artists to stardom.
Musical Achievements
Diddy's musical achievements are a testament to his versatility and creativity. As an artist, he has released several successful albums, including "No Way Out," which won a Grammy Award for Best Rap Album. His hit singles, such as "I'll Be Missing You" and "Can't Nobody Hold Me Down," have topped charts worldwide and earned him numerous accolades.
Beyond his solo career, Diddy has collaborated with some of the biggest names in the music industry, including Jay-Z, Usher, and Mariah Carey. His ability to adapt to changing musical trends and produce chart-topping hits has solidified his reputation as a trailblazer in the industry.
Business Ventures
Diddy's entrepreneurial spirit extends far beyond the music industry. He has ventured into various business endeavors, including fashion, beverages, and media. His clothing line, Sean John, launched in 1998, quickly became a staple in urban fashion and earned him the CFDA Menswear Designer of the Year award in 2004.
In addition to fashion, Diddy has made significant investments in the beverage industry. He partnered with Diageo to promote Ciroc vodka, a brand that has achieved remarkable success under his guidance. His involvement in the media industry includes the launch of Revolt TV, a music-oriented cable network that reflects his passion for innovation and entertainment.
